14SD817R: DB026 Delica Metallic Dark Steel 11/0 - 9GM

Miyuki Delica DB026 in Metallic Dark Steel brings the precision of Japanese tube-cut 11/0 Delicas to a deep, gunmetal-toned colorway that works hard in structural beadwork. The 9g retail quantity gives you enough to commit to a full piece without overcommitting to a colorway you haven't tried yet.

The solid metallic finish delivers a strong, mirror-like shine with genuine depth — dark enough to read as near-black in low light, bright enough to catch the light and hold attention.

Specifications

  • Size: 11/0
  • Color: Greys and Blacks (mixed)
  • Material: Glass, made in Japan
  • Quantity: 9g

What to make with them

The uniform cylindrical shape of Delicas makes DB026 a natural choice for loom work, peyote, and brick stitch where tight bead-to-bead alignment matters — think geometric cuffs, mosaic pendants, or intricate off-loom panels where the metallic surface adds dimension without introducing color noise. It also pairs well as a contrast bead in herringbone ropes or RAW components alongside silvers, blacks, and deep jewel tones.
